Key Features to Consider

When evaluating compact SUVs with AWD, several factors should be taken into account. These include engine performance, fuel economy, interior space, technology offerings, and safety ratings. Below are some of the most critical aspects to consider:

  • Engine Performance: Look for a balance between power and efficiency. Turbocharged engines are common in this segment, providing ample torque without excessive fuel consumption.
  • Fuel Economy: AWD systems can impact fuel efficiency, so opt for models with advanced drivetrain technologies that minimize this effect.
  • Interior Space: Compact SUVs should offer comfortable seating and ample cargo space, making them practical for families and travelers.
  • Technology: Modern infotainment systems, smartphone integration, and driver-assistance features enhance the overall driving experience.
  • Safety: Look for high safety ratings and advanced features like adaptive cruise control, lane-keeping assist, and automatic emergency braking.

Top Compact SUVs with AWD in 2025

The following vehicles stand out in the compact SUV segment for their AWD capabilities, overall performance, and value:

Model Starting Price (USD)Engine MPG (City/Hwy) Key Features
Toyota RAV4$28,500 2.5L 4-cylinder27/35 Standard AWD, Toyota Safety Sense 3.0
Honda CR-V$29,000 1.5L Turbo 4-cylinder28/34 Spacious interior, Honda Sensing Suite
Subaru Forester$27,500 2.5L 4-cylinder26/33 Standard AWD, EyeSight Driver Assist
Mazda CX-5$28,000 2.5L 4-cylinder25/31 Luxury interior, Skyactiv-G engine

Benefits of All-Wheel Drive

AWD systems provide several advantages, especially for drivers in regions with unpredictable weather or rough terrains. These systems distribute power to all four wheels, improving traction and stability. Key benefits include:

  • Enhanced Safety: AWD reduces the risk of skidding or losing control on slippery surfaces.
  • Improved Performance: Better acceleration and handling, particularly in challenging conditions.
  • Versatility: Suitable for both city driving and light off-roading.

Latest Innovations in AWD Technology

Automakers are continuously refining AWD systems to improve efficiency and performance. Some of the latest advancements include:

  • Torque Vectoring: Enhances cornering stability by distributing power unevenly between wheels.
  • Disconnecting AWD: Systems that deactivate the rear axle when not needed to save fuel.
  • Hybrid AWD: Combines electric motors with traditional engines for better efficiency.
